Output d942a74a6d79bf89c18dba20dabfd14e80f45390893f27f25f61562d8de5eb4b:0

value
27919146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ecf9f7cd436c9fca5ea4ac94ad5ba0fad26abcd5 OP_EQUAL
address
3PJ2qtsdBo7XChHcWp1PtYJZ5Ro367VdFv
transaction
d942a74a6d79bf89c18dba20dabfd14e80f45390893f27f25f61562d8de5eb4b
spent
true